Refer

/rɪˈfɜː/
To direct someone to a source of information or send them to someone for help or advice.

Etymology:

etymology
The word refer comes from the late Middle English referer, derived from Latin referre, meaning to carry back, report, or relate. The Latin term is a combination of re- meaning back and ferre meaning to carry.
